Output 63ca13581b583412deec97d105be60a22060f8c894236bd55c2736d55cb102dd:5

value
3684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b2965ad5d1740bbca081ee49eaae611723c65f9abde170213e0608934768e2f
address
bc1pav5ktt2azaqthjsgrmjfa2hxz9erce0e400pwqsnupsgjdrk3chsy7ggkf
transaction
63ca13581b583412deec97d105be60a22060f8c894236bd55c2736d55cb102dd
spent
true